Star Performer 100mm – Cellular Concrete Block

The Star Performer Cellular Concrete Block is a cellular dense aggregate block designed with three internal cavities to deliver excellent thermal efficiency and strength. Unlike traditional solid dense blocks, the three-cavity design reduces weight without compromising load-bearing capability, offering compressive strengths of 7.3 N/mm². This concrete block achieves a thermal performance around 45% better than solid dense blocks, making it a ideal choice for both energy efficiency and structural reliability.

These blocks are easier to handle and quicker to lay, improving on site productivity. Suitable for a wide range of applications including inner leaf walls, party walls, and below DPC, the Star Performer Cellular Block provides a one block solution for modern construction needs.

Technical Specifications:

  • Thermal Efficiency: 0.65 W/mK, improves substantially with insulation.
  • Dimensions: 440mm (Length) x 215mm (Height) x 100mm (Width)
  • Strength: 7.3N
  • Acoustic Performance: 45 dB reduction (meets part E)
  • Weight: 15kg aprox
  • Fire Resistance: load bearing: 2 hours | Non load bearing: 4 hours
  • Coverage: 10 blocks covers 1 m²
  • Moisture Management: Requires external render or cladding; not for fair-faced exposure
  • Standards & Marking: BS EN 771-1 manufactured; UKCA marked
  • Mortar Joint: 10 mm recommended (BS 8000-3 compliant)

What mortar joint thickness should I use?

Use a 10 mm mortar joint for correct bedding and alignment.

Can I render or plaster onto them directly?

Yes. Their surface provides a strong key, just make sure to brush off debris and rake back any smooth mortar joints.

What fire rating do they provide?

For load bearing walls 2 hours and for non-loadbearing 4 hours of fire resistance.
